Imagination activates Ford at MWC 2015

Creative agency Imagination was tasked with designing a socially-connected space for automotive brand Ford at this year's Mobile World Congress (MWC) expo.

The activation centred on a ‘Connected Journey’ concept, focusing on Ford’s Smart Mobility plan to use innovation to take the brand to the next level in connectivity and mobility. The plan began with 25 mobility experiments and developer challenges internationally, with more launching throughout 2015 to help change the way the world moves.

Visitors to Ford’s stand were given the opportunity to understand the scale of the mobility issues, through content and learning tools, and experience Ford’s work on mobility challenges. Delegates were also able to experience first-hand the experiments through a number of activations, which also generated data for Ford on the mobility concerns of today and hopes for the future.

Michael Baumann, executive director, governmental and public affairs, Ford of Europe, said: "At Ford we're innovating in every part of our business and with Ford Smart Mobility we show our commitment to keep the world moving.

"We are very excited to share our vision and our latest mobility experiments at this very important tech show."

Alex Poetter, managing director and creative director at Imagination Deutschland GmbH, added: "This has been an exciting project from the start and we are very pleased to be able to help Ford showcase these important experiments at an event such as MWC.

"This is a key audience for Ford and we hope to have created a place where they can take their own deep dive into Ford’s innovative work."

This was the fourth consecutive year that Ford has exhibited at Mobile World Congress, with the brand being the first automotive company to do so.
